1989 Lamborghini Jalpa vs. 2005 Panoz Esperante

To start off, 2005 Panoz Esperante is newer by 16 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1989 Lamborghini Jalpa.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1989 Lamborghini Jalpa would be higher. At 4,601 cc (8 cylinders), 2005 Panoz Esperante is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2005 Panoz Esperante (317 HP @ 6000 RPM) has 65 more horse power than 1989 Lamborghini Jalpa. (252 HP @ 7000 RPM) In normal driving conditions, 2005 Panoz Esperante should accelerate faster than 1989 Lamborghini Jalpa.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 1989 Lamborghini Jalpa weights approximately 228 kg more than 2005 Panoz Esperante.

Both vehicles are rear wheel drive (RWD) - it offers better handling in dry conditions; in addition, if you are looking to drift, both vehicles do the job better than front wheel drive vehicles.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 2005 Panoz Esperante (426 Nm @ 4750 RPM) has 112 more torque (in Nm) than 1989 Lamborghini Jalpa. (314 Nm @ 3500 RPM). This means 2005 Panoz Esperante will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1989 Lamborghini Jalpa.

Compare all specifications:

1989 Lamborghini Jalpa 2005 Panoz Esperante
Make Lamborghini Panoz
Model Jalpa Esperante
Year Released 1989 2005
Body Type Coupe Coupe
Engine Position Middle Front
Engine Size 3485 cc 4601 cc
Engine Cylinders 8 cylinders 8 cylinders
Engine Type V V
Valves per Cylinder 2 valves 4 valves
Horse Power 252 HP 317 HP
Engine RPM 7000 RPM 6000 RPM
Torque 314 Nm 426 Nm
Torque RPM 3500 RPM 4750 RPM
Fuel Type Gasoline Gasoline
Top Speed 227 km/hour 250 km/hour
Drive Type Rear Rear
Transmission Type Manual Manual
Number of Seats 2 seats 2 seats
Number of Doors 2 doors 2 doors
Vehicle Weight 1500 kg 1272 kg
Vehicle Length 4340 mm 4480 mm
Vehicle Width 1890 mm 1860 mm
Vehicle Height 1150 mm 1360 mm
Wheelbase Size 2460 mm 2700 mm
Fuel Tank Capacity 80 L 59 L
